| Aspect | Concrete Owner Driver | Concrete Truck Driver |
|---|
| Credentials | Driver's license, possibly a commercial license, and vehicle registration | Driver's license, commercial license often required |
| Work Environment | Owns or leases a concrete truck, operates independently or for a company | Works for a company, operates company-owned trucks |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Self-employed or contracted within the construction and concrete industry | Employed by concrete or construction companies |
| Search & Comparison Intent | Looking for independent concrete delivery roles or owning a truck | Seeking employment as a concrete delivery driver |
The main difference is that a Concrete Owner Driver owns or leases their truck and operates independently, often managing their own schedule and clients. In contrast, a Concrete Truck Driver typically works for a company, operating company-owned trucks. Both roles require similar licenses and work within the concrete industry, but the ownership and employment structure differ significantly.
